WebJun 16, 2024 · Yes, you can get uniqueness for the Fourier transform from uniqueness for Fourier series, by a Poisson-summation sort of argument. But it's very simple to do directly. Note I'm omitting the 2 π s: Lemma. If f, g ∈ L 1 ( R) then ∫ f ^ g = ∫ f g ^. Proof. Fubini. Prop. If f ∈ L 1 and f ^ = 0 then f = 0 a.e.
